Position Summary
The Accountant is instrumental in ensuring the University of the Incarnate Word and related entities are in compliance with tax and debt regulations, reporting requirements, and provides annual audit support. The Accountant analyzes and reconciles various accounts and serves as a resource/liaison to academic and administrative departments. The Accountant reports to the Director of Financial Operations.

Job Duties
Job Duty Name Tax
Description Of Job Duties
- Assists in the preparation/submission of the university tax returns, including but not limited to Forms 990 and 990-T.
- Ensures compliance with collection and remittance of sales tax and hotel occupancy tax to both state and local governments.
- Collaborates with relevant institutional departments to ensure compliance with applicable federal, state, and local tax regulations.
- Conducts research on legislative changes that may impact the university.
- Responds to inquiries accurately and in a timely manner.
Description Of Job Duties
- Prepares annual financial audit work papers.
- Collaborates with external auditors in the preparation of the annual benefits audit.
- Prepares confirmation letters.
- Prepares annual compliance documents and associated supplementary information.
- Responds to audit inquiries accurately and in a timely manner.
Description Of Job Duties
- Prepares annual debt disclosure requirement summary.
- Prepares Moody’s annual disclosure request.
- Prepares quarterly and annual financial statements for international joint ventures.
- Assists in the preparation of quarterly and annual financial statements for international consolidated entities.
- Prepares quarterly compliance documents.
Description Of Job Duties
- Prepares monthly reconciliations and journal entries as needed.
- Maintains/retains documents in accordance with retention policy.
- Assists in the preparation of the annual debt service budget.
- Provides guidance and mentoring to student employees.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
